Democracy is a form of government in which the people hold power. This means that the people have a say in how they are governed, and that their elected representatives make decisions on their behalf. There are many different types of democracy, but they all share the same basic principle: that the people should have a say in how they are governed.

Diplomacy is the art of conducting negotiations between countries. It is a way of resolving disputes peacefully and of building relationships between countries. Diplomacy is often used to prevent war, but it can also be used to resolve conflicts that have already broken out.

Socialism is an economic and political system in which the means of production are owned and controlled by the people, either directly or through the state. Socialism is based on the idea that everyone should have an equal opportunity to succeed, and that the benefits of economic activity should be shared by everyone.

Autocracy is a form of government in which one person or a small group of people holds all the power. Autocracies are often characterized by the absence of freedom of speech and the rule of law.
